GE PACSystems RX3i IC695CPE310 Central Processing Unit


GE PACSystems RX3i IC695CPE310 Central Processing Unit

INTRODUCTION

The PACSystems* RX3i CPE310 can be used to perform real time control of machines, processes, and material handling systems. The CPU communicates with the programmer via the internal Ethernet port or a serial port. It communicates with I/O and Intelligent Option modules over a dual PCI/serial backplane.

BENEFITS

■ Contains 10 Mbytes of user memory and 10 Mbytes of non-volatile flash user memory. 

■ Battery-less retention of user memory. 

■ Optional Energy Pack on system power loss powers CPU long enough to write user memory to nonvolatile storage (NVS). 

■ Configurable data and program memory. 

■ Programming in Ladder Diagram, Structured Text, Function Block Diagram, and C. 

■ Supports auto-located Symbolic Variables that can use any amount of user memory. 

■ Reference table sizes include 32Kbits for discrete %I and %Q and up to 32Kwords each for analog %AI and %AQ. 

■ Supports most Series 90-30 modules and expansion racks. For supported I/O, Communications, Motion, and Intelligent modules, see the PACSystems RX3i Hardware and Installation Manual, GFK-2314. 

■ Supports up to 512 program blocks. Maximum size for a block is 128KB. 

■ Two serial ports: RS-485 and RS-232. 

■ Embedded Ethernet interface supports a maximum of two programmer connections. 

■ The rack-based Ethernet Interface module (IC695ETM001) supports a complete set of Ethernet functionality. For details, see TCP/IP Ethernet Communications, GFK-2224. 

■ Time synchronization to SNTP Time Server on Ethernet network when used with a rack-based Ethernet module (IC695ETM001) version 5.0 or later. 

■ Ability to display serial number and date code in programmer Device Information Details. 

■ Ability to transfer applications to and from USB 2.0 A-type compatible RDSDs (removable data storage devices). 

■ Compliant with EU RoHS Directive 2002/95/EC using the following exemptions identified in the Annex: 7(a), 7(c)-I and III, and 15.

Specifications

Program storage:10 Mbytes of non-volatile flash user memory.

Operating Temperature:0 to 60°C (32°F to 140°F)

Boolean execution speed, typical:0.072 mS per 1000 Boolean instructions

Time of Day Clock accuracy:Maximum drift of 2 seconds per day

Elapsed Time Clock (internal timing) accuracy:0.01% maximum

Serial Protocols supported:Modbus RTU Slave, SNP Slave, Serial I/O

Ethernet data rate:10Mb/sec and 100Mb/Sec
